I.C. Industrial Sunscreen 57.5 mg/mL
ZINC OXIDE, OCTINOXATE, OXYBENZONE, and OCTISALATE · LOTION · R & R Lotion, Inc
I.C. Industrial Sunscreen is a lotion containing zinc oxide, octinoxate, oxybenzone, and octisalate at 57.5 mg/mL, taken topical. Manufactured by R & R Lotion, Inc.
